business class
noun
ukus [ U ] TRANSPORT
a type of air travel that is more expensive and has better conditions than economy class, or the part of a plane where people who have booked this type of travel sit:
Most of the special deals on flights are for business class only.
Complimentary drinks will be served to passengers in business class.
business-class passengers/seats/tickets
Compare
economy class
first class adjective
[ C ]
a set of classes or a course of study in which the principles or methods of business are taught:
He got a promotion after taking business classes in the evening.
[ C or U ] MANAGEMENT
the group of people within society who own or have important positions in companies:
During the election campaign, the Republican Party lost support among the business class.
